Sofia Faces Problems with 4th Iraq Unit Equipment
Politics | October 15, 2004, Friday
Bulgaria is having some problems with finding equipment for the country's fourth Iraq peacekeeping unit. Photo by BNT
The Chief of Bulgarian Army Staff General Nikola Kolev revealed that Defence Minister Nikolay Svinarov has pledged to deliver the needed equipment within a month.
Kolev also explained that so far Sofia is not planning to boost its presence in Iraq by sending more troops to the war-torn country.
Nearly 500 Bulgarian troops are deployed in the southern Iraqi city of Karbala under the commandment of Polish multinational contingent.
